The Hexadecimal Color #B1781A is a contrast shade of Dark Goldenrod. #B1781A RGB value is rgb(177, 120, 26). RGB Color Model of #B1781A consists of 69% red, 47% green and 10% blue. HSL color Mode of #B1781A has 37°(degrees) Hue, 74% Saturation and 40% Lightness. #B1781A color has an wavelength of 596.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B1781A is #CC9933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B1781A is #A72. The Closest Color to #B1781A is #B8860B. Official Name of #B1781A Hex Code is Mandalay.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B1781A is 0 Cyan 32 Magenta 85 Yellow 31 Black and #B1781A CMY is 0, 32, 85.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B1781A is hsl(37,74,40,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(37, 85, 69).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B1781A is 25.04, 22.86, 4.07.
Hex8 Value of #B1781A is #B1781AFF. Decimal Value of #B1781A is 11630618 and Octal Value of #B1781A is 54274032. Binary Value of #B1781A is 10110001, 1111000, 11010 and Android of #B1781A is 4289820698 / 0xffb1781a.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B1781A is 0.482, 0.44, 0.44 and YIQ Color Space of #B1781A is 126.327, 64.1685, -17.1973.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B1781A is 27.51, 21.21, 4.39.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B1781A is 54.93, 14.81, 55.42.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B1781A is 54.93, 46.87, 52.02.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B1781A is 54.93, 57.36, 75.04. Hunter Lab variable of #B1781A is 47.81, 9.81, 28.42.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B1781A

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
